Triple Chocolate Cream Pie
Triple Chocolate Cream Pie requires around 1 hour from start to finish. This recipe serves 8. One serving contains 1323 calories, 14g of protein, and 72g of fat. Instructions
To make the dark chocolate layer, place the dark chocolate, miniature marshmallows, milk, and salt into the top of a double boiler over medium heat. Stir until chocolate melts and mixture is smooth.
Remove from the heat, and stir in the vanilla. Allow to cool, stirring occasionally.
Beat the heavy cream in a bowl until soft peaks form. Fold the whipped cream into the dark chocolate mixture until evenly blended. Spoon the mixture into the prepared graham cracker crust.
Spread 1/2 chocolate whipped topping over the dark chocolate layer. Refrigerate at least 30 minutes.
Meanwhile, make the milk chocolate layer by placing the milk chocolate, miniature marshmallows, milk, and salt into the top of a double boiler over medium heat. Stir until chocolate melts, and mixture is smooth.
Remove from the heat, and stir in the vanilla. Allow to cool, stirring occasionally.
Beat the remaining 1/2 cup heavy cream in a bowl until soft peaks form. Fold the whipped cream into the milk chocolate mixture until evenly blended.
Pour the mixture over chocolate topping layer.
Spread the remaining chocolate whipped topping over the milk chocolate layer. Spoon the whipped topping over the chocolate topping. If desired, garnish with miniature chocolate chips.
